
Kenyan social media has been set ablaze following Gloria Kyallo’s revelation that she and her ex-boyfriend, Ken Warui, are co-parenting their dog.
Gloria, the younger sister of media personality Betty Kyallo, shared this information during a Q&A session with her followers, sparking an intense debate online.
Gloria’s Statement on Co-Parenting the Dog
When asked why she and Ken broke up, Gloria responded vaguely, saying:
"Neither here nor there, but I feel loved and very content."
However, what truly caught people's attention was her disclosure that despite their breakup, she and Ken still co-parent their dog.
"I answered this question before, it's on my highlight even. Anyway, we do co-parent the dog, but since the dog belongs to him, I see links from time to time," she explained.
While some saw this as a sign of maturity and mutual respect, others found the idea strange and unnecessary.

Gloria’s Love for Dogs
Gloria has always been vocal about her deep love for pets. In May 2023, she revealed that she had hired a nanny specifically to take care of her three dogs: Nala, Shaggi, and Lulu.
"I do so much to take care of my puppies… like at the moment they are at home with the nanny. Yes, I got them a nanny because they are my babies and they need someone to take care of them," she explained.
She also dismissed critics who mocked her for calling her pets "babies."
"People should just leave me alone if I call my dogs my babies. I will call them what I want. They have not started school, but they are living well," she said confidently.

How Much Does Gloria Spend on Her Dogs?
For Gloria, no amount is too much when it comes to spoiling her furry companions. She revealed that she spends at least Ksh500 per day on her dogs.
"At least Ksh500 a day is okay for me to spoil them. I am working for them and my future family," she said.
